[ 
https://issues.apache.org/jira/browse/OFBIZ-3633?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12854686#action_12854686
 ] 

Bob Morley commented on OFBIZ-3633:
-----------------------------------

Ok I ran to the office with my boy (almost the big 1) and got my "The data 
Model Resource Book - Volume 1".  I want to quote a few things from page 81 on 
this book (going back to SupplierProduct).  Starting just in the section titled 
"Suppliers and Manufacturers of Products" ...

"... the entity SUPPLIER PRODUCT shows which products are offered by which 
organizations.  The available from date and available thru date state when the 
product is offered by that supplier.  This information is important because it 
provides the capability to find out where and when specific products may be 
purchased, what prodcuts competitors sell, and which products the enterprise 
sells."

I thought "the enterprise" would refer to the company, and the last paragraph 
starts "Because there may be many suppliers from which the enterprise can order 
products ...".  Which would lead me to believe the Enterprise is definitely one 
of the internal organizations parented by "Company".

Finally on page 83 there is a table (3.4) that shows ABC Corporation being a 
supplier of the product (along with other suppliers - in this case likely 
people ABC would order from).  They describe this by "Table 3.4 provides 
examples of the suppliers that provide "Johnson fine grade 81 1/2 by 11 bond 
paper."  Notice that the enterprise, ABC Corporation, sells this product; and 
if the enterprise does not have this product in stock, there are two other 
sources for obtaining this product."

I have made a few assumptions here -- 1) Ofbiz adheres to this data modeling 
book pretty religiously and 2) not everyone may have the book so I had to type 
the quotes as opposed to just referring pages.  Let me know if either of those 
are incorrect.

> Minimum order quantity
> ----------------------
>
>                 Key: OFBIZ-3633
>                 URL: https://issues.apache.org/jira/browse/OFBIZ-3633
>             Project: OFBiz
>          Issue Type: New Feature
>          Components: order, specialpurpose/ecommerce
>            Reporter: Rishi Solanki
>             Fix For: SVN trunk
>
>         Attachments: OFBIZ-3633.patch, OFBIZ-3633.patch
>
>
> It will work as follows;
> We will set the special type price as 'MINIMUM_ORDER_PRICE' for a Product in 
> ProductPrice entity. On the basis of it we will get the minimum order 
> quantity of the product on the basis of this price and sale price.
> Will get the minimum order quantity for product by division. For example we 
> have selling price of product P1 is $10.00 and its MINIMUM_ORDER_PRICE is 
> $100.00 then minimum order quantity for the product will be --> 100/10 ==> 10.
> To achieve the above ;
> write a getMinimumOrderQuantity() method in ShoppingCart.java which takes the 
> itemBasePrice and productId as in parameter, and call it where we add, update 
> the cart items and change the quantity to minmumOrderQuantity if it is less 
> then minimum.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.

Reply via email to